Output d3f51ea875f3bbf347f25d71dbef17787850365fa31d6db27c885f95bedfaf70:0

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0b6efb8836397332fdeb83a402dc71c31c93cf2 OP_EQUAL
address
3PdoFE9toHuHy7iqcW77Lair5fasYo3kmR
transaction
d3f51ea875f3bbf347f25d71dbef17787850365fa31d6db27c885f95bedfaf70
confirmations
176045
spent
true